Literature summary for 3.4.22.49 extracted from

  • Stegmeier, F.; Visintin, R.; Amon, A.
    Separase, polo kinase, the kinetochore protein Slk19, and Spo12 function in a network that controls Cdc14 localization during early anaphase (2002), Cell, 108, 207-220.
    View publication on PubMed

Organism

Organism UniProt Comment Textmining
Saccharomyces cerevisiae
-
separase is part of the so called Cdc fourteen anaphase release network, that promotes Cdc14 release from the nucleolus during early anaphase
